The purpose of this session is to provide participants with a good understanding of the loan documentation process for Consumer and Commercial Loans. Participants will be exposed to the five steps in the loan documentation process and the documents required to accomplish each step in the process. The Loan Documentation Process includes identifying documents to:
1. Identify the Legal Status of Consumers and the Various Forms of Commercial Borrowers 2. Identify and Properly Place Assets Taken as Collateral into the Proper Collateral Category and Obtaining a Proper Valuation of the Collateral 3. Evidence the Debt to Detail the Mutual Understanding of the Loan Arrangement Between the Bank and the Borrower 4. Attach the Collateral Which Allows a Lending Institution to Seize, Foreclose Upon and Sell the Collateral for Repayment of the Loan 5. Perfect the Security Interest to Insure the Bank’s Collateral Position is Superior to Other Creditors
Each of the five steps requires certain documents to accomplish their respective purpose. The participant will develop an understanding of each of these documents and know when to use them.
